I have checked the (Top Paid Apps) sample code from Apple website where you can see all the top apps in the App store, I want to do the same in my app but to show only my apps in the App Store. Here is the URL which i found in that sample :

http://phobos.apple.com/WebObjects/MZStoreServices.woa/ws/RSS/toppaidapplications/limit=75/xml

What do I need to change in this URL to show only my Apps?

This is pretty easy with the SKStoreProductViewController introduced in iOS 6. With that users can buy your other apps right within the application.

First add StoreKit.framework to your project. Then find the iTunes URL that links to your apps using iTunes. You can copy the link from the iTunes Store. For example the URL for the Apple apps is http://itunes.apple.com/de/artist/apple/id284417353?mt=12 It contains the iTunes identifier, that you pass to the SKStoreProductViewController.

Sample code:

#import "ViewController.h"
#import <StoreKit/SKStoreProductViewController.h>

@interface ViewController ()<SKStoreProductViewControllerDelegate>
@end

@implementation ViewController

- (void)viewDidLoad
{
    [super viewDidLoad];
    [self showMyApps];
}

-(void)showMyApps
{
    SKStoreProductViewController* spvc = [[SKStoreProductViewController alloc] init];
    [spvc loadProductWithParameters:@{SKStoreProductParameterITunesItemIdentifier : @284417353}
                    completionBlock:nil];
    spvc.delegate = self;
    [self presentViewController:spvc animated:YES completion:nil];

}

-(void)productViewControllerDidFinish:(SKStoreProductViewController *)viewController
{
    [self dismissViewControllerAnimated:YES completion:nil];
}

@end

You could use DAAppsViewController. It can be configured with a developer ID to show all the apps by that developer. It will use StoreKit if available, otherwise fallback to switching to the App Store.
